Handover Note — Gross-Margin Review

To: incoming director. Margin review for the Kelsor division is half complete. Q2 bridge done; Q3 pending plant data from Ravensmoor. Flag: logistics costs misallocated under the old coding — restated figures attached. Board expects the full picture next month. Keep Arlan's team on the reconciliation. One confidential item must be noted here.

management briefing: Project Ulavan slips by two quarters because of the staffing delay.

**branchsweep-bot 3.2 — changed defaults**

Default retention for stale branches dropped from 180 to 60 days. Protected-branch patterns are now deny-by-default; the old wildcard allow was a review finding from the Ostrow audit. Dry-run mode off by default in org-scoped installs. Security should confirm the new scopes match policy. Effective defaults shipping with 3.2 follow below.

service settings:
wenix:
  pin: 0857
  metrics_host: metrics.wenix.lumiclabs.internal
  tenant: ulavan
  seal: seal_db298014

Over the holiday period, Vantrey House operates reduced hours: the building opens at 09:30 and closes at 16:00 from 20 December until 3 January. New starters should note that reception is unstaffed during this window and visitors cannot be signed in. If you need access outside these hours, arrange it with your line manager in advance and enter via the rear entrance using the code below.

staff pass of kawip-hawef = bdg-QLP-2